Form 4: Timken Director Kyle Reports RSU Vesting and Tax Sale
Insider Transaction Report
Timken Co. Director Richard G. Kyle reported the vesting of restricted stock units and a subsequent tax-related sale of shares.
Summary
- Richard G. Kyle, a Director of Timken Co. (TKR), reported transactions involving the company's common stock.
- On February 10, 2026, 7,023 shares of common stock were acquired at a price of $0, representing the vesting of 25% of time-based restricted share units granted on February 10, 2022.
- Following this acquisition, Kyle's direct beneficial ownership was 252,495 shares.
- Also on February 10, 2026, 2,792 shares of common stock were disposed of at a price of $109.23 per share.
- After both transactions, Kyle's direct beneficial ownership of common stock stands at 249,703 shares.
